Boosting Efficiency via Lean and Six Sigma

Organizations continuously strive to enhance their operational efficiency and reduce waste. To accomplish this, many employ the powerful methodologies of Lean and Six Sigma. Lean focuses on eliminating non-value-added activities from processes, while Six Sigma aims on reducing process variation and defects. By integrating these two approaches, businesses can achieve significant improvements in quality, velocity, and ultimately, customer satisfaction.

Lean and Six Sigma provide a structured framework for assessing processes, identifying bottlenecks, and implementing solutions to optimize performance. This often involves educating employees in the principles of both methodologies, empowering them to become active participants in process improvement initiatives. The result is a culture of continuous optimization that drives sustainable success.

Implementing a Culture of Quality: The Power of Six Sigma DMAIC

In today's fiercely competitive landscape, businesses strive to deliver products and services that consistently meet or exceed customer expectations. To achieve this level of excellence, organizations must foster a culture of quality that permeates every aspect of their operations. One powerful framework for implementing such a culture is Six Sigma DMAIC, a data-driven methodology designed to minimize defects and improve processes.

This structured approach provides a roadmap for teams to identify problems, gather data, analyze root causes, develop solutions, and implement controls to ensure sustained improvement. By following the DMAIC cycle, organizations can enhance their processes, leading to increased customer satisfaction, reduced costs, and improved operational efficiency.

  • Organizations that embrace Six Sigma DMAIC often experience a significant transformation in their organizational culture. Employees become more engaged to contribute to quality initiatives, and there is a greater emphasis on data-driven decision-making.
  • Furthermore, Six Sigma DMAIC promotes continuous improvement, encouraging teams to periodically analyze their processes and identify areas for further optimization.

Ultimately, implementing a culture of quality through the power of Six Sigma DMAIC is essential for organizations seeking to thrive in today's dynamic environment.

Optimizing Processes Through Lean: A Guide to Increased Efficiency

In today's constantly shifting business landscape, organizations are always striving ways to enhance efficiency and productivity. Lean principles offer a powerful framework for obtaining these goals by concentrating on the elimination of waste and the improvement of workflows. By adopting lean methodologies, businesses can drastically minimize lead times, {improveoverall process quality, and ultimately increase profitability.

  • Adopting a culture of continuous improvement through kaizen
  • Recognizing and removing sources of waste in processes
  • Standardizing key workflows for reliability

These methodologies are not merely a set of rigid rules but rather a approach that encourages collaboration, employee empowerment, and a data-driven approach to decision making. By embracing lean principles into their operations, organizations can unlock the potential for sustainable growth and stay ahead in the ever-changing marketplace.
